          <h4 style="font-family: Rubik; text-align: left; margin-top: 1%">BBa_K274371 – P2 Phage Sensitivity Tuner</h4>
 
           <p>This part is made up of an RBS (BBa_B0034), an org activator coding sequence (BBa_I746350) from P2 phage, the double terminator BBa_B0015 (made up of BBa_B0010 and BBa_B0012) and the inducible promoter PO (BBa_I746361) from P2 phage.</p>

          <h4 style="font-family: Rubik; text-align: left; margin-top: 1%">BBa_K274381 – PSP3 Phage Sensitivity Tuner</h4>
 
           <p>This part is made up of an RBS (BBa_B0034), a pag activator coding sequence (BBa_I746351) from PSP3 phage, the double terminator BBa_B0015 (made up of BBa_B0010 and BBa_B0012) and the inducible promoter PO (BBa_I746361) from P2 phage.</p>

           <h2 style="font-family: Rubik; text-align: left; margin-top: 1%"> Implementation </h2>
 
           <h2 style="font-family: Rubik; text-align: left; margin-top: 1%"> Implementation </h2>
 
           <p>The chromoproteins aeBlue (BBa_K1033929), amajLime (BBa_K1033915) and spisPink (BBa_K1033925) parts were requested from the iGEM parts registry. Upon arrival, parts were transformed in DH5α E. coli cells [Protocol link]. Colonies were picked and overnight cultures were prepared for miniprepping [Protocol link]. Minipreps were digested [Protocol link] with XbaI and PstI for BioBrick assembly [Protocol link].
